The story of Maria Fitz Gerald de Carew began in 1110 in Cheshire, England. Maria Fitz Gerald de Carew married William Fitzgerald Baron Of Windsor And Pembroke, and had children including Raymond Fitzwalter Fitzgerald Constable Of Leinster. Maria Fitz Gerald de Carew passed away in 1150 in Carrucastle in County Pembroke, England.
